The Linguistic Sanctuary: Unlocking Gullah Language and Origins

The Gullah Language and Origins represent one of the most remarkable linguistic triumphs in the Western Hemisphere. Spoken along the coastal lowlands from North Carolina to Florida, Gullah (also known as Sea Island Creole English) is a vibrant, deeply resonant tongue forged by enslaved West and Central African ancestors who maintained their linguistic sovereignty despite brutal systemic oppression.
